Sounds with a frequency of 20 Hz and lower are called infrasound . Low frequency sound is understood to mean sound, the frequency of which is below 125 Hz. Infrasound and low frequency sound are difficult to hear, but they cannot be called completely inaudible.

At the other end of the spectrum are very low-frequency sounds (below 20 Hz), known as infrasound. Elephants use infrasound for communication , making sounds too low for humans to hear. Sound at 20-200 Hz is called low-frequency sound, while for sound below 20 Hz the term infrasound is used. The hearing becomes gradually less sensitive for decreasing frequency, but despite the general understanding that infrasound is inaudible, humans can perceive infrasound, if the level is sufficiently high .
